The Pulaski County Assessor's Office lists you as the owner of parcel # 34L3420000700 located at east of
Arch Street Pike, south of I-30 in Little Rock, Arkansas.
The Department of Planning and Development has been in the process of reviewing the Land Use Plan
and Zoning for the area in and around your property. The proposed changes are a result of discussions and
review by city staff. Your property is currently shown as Mining. There is a proposal to change the Land
Use category for your property to Park/Open Space to represent the floodway in this area.
A list of Land Use Plan categories is attached as well as a brochure concerning Land Use Plan
Amendments. A change to the Land Use Plan does not change your zoning or taxes.
Please contact us indicating your wishes to the address above before November 1, 2008. If no response is
given, the planning staff will view this as an acceptance of the change in the Land Use Plan category. The
change will then be taken before the Planning Commission and later to the Board of Directors. The
Planning Commission meeting is held at City Hall at 4:00 p.m. on November 13, 2008.
